What is CVE-2023-53302?
A vulnerability in the Linux kernel's iwl4965 Wi-Fi driver has been identified, where the absence of a return value check for the create_singlethread_workqueue() function could lead to a NULL pointer dereference. This oversight has been corrected in recent updates, enhancing the reliability and security of the driver. Users are encouraged to update their systems to mitigate any potential risks associated with this vulnerability.
